Wilson 23rd and Bargwanna 29th in Phillip Island practice PDF Print E-mail
Friday, 30 November 2007
WPS/WOW Racing drivers Max Wilson and Jason Bargwanna have driven to 23rd and 29th respectively in practice for the Dunlop Grand Finale at Phillip Island in Victoria today.

Wilson set a time of 1m35.5435s around the 4.45 kilometre Phillip Island Grand Prix Circuit in the #8 WOW Racing Falcon, within a second of the times in the top 10. “Phillip Island is a great circuit and today was a solid start to the weekend,” saidmaxgrasspi-th.jpg Wilson.

“I’m confident that the WOW car will be around the mark. We will look at things now and see where we can improve the car for qualifying tomorrow.”

Bargwanna steered the #10 WPS Racing Falcon to a time of 1m35.9558s at Phillip Island in the two and a half hour, limited lap session.

bargsmghairpin-th.jpg“I think with some changes overnight we can get the car closer to the pace for qualifying tomorrow,” said Bargwanna.

Mark Winterbottom was fastest today ahead of Garth Tander and Todd Kelly.

“Max has made a solid start to the weekend today and I am sure that with the correct changes we can be better tomorrow for qualifying,” said WPS/WOW Racing Team Owner Craig Gore.

Tomorrow will see qualifying and the opening race of the Dunlop Grand Finale held at Phillip Island.
